Bournemouth Join £30m Transfer Race for Bundesliga Star Bournemouth Enter Race for Malik Tillman Amid Premier League Interest Bournemouth’s recruitment strategy has often been defined by precision rather than spectacle, yet their reported interest in Malik Tillman signals a growing ambition to compete more aggressively in the transfer market. According to TeamTalk , the Cherries have joined a competitive queue for the Bayer Leverkusen midfielder, a player already open to the idea of testing himself in England. Tillman’s situation at Bayer Leverkusen has developed with unusual speed.
Having arrived from PSV Eindhoven for €35million, his early months have not quite delivered the consistent opportunities expected. Under manager Kasper Hjulmand , game time has been limited, and that has inevitably sparked interest from elsewhere. Growing Premier League Competition Interest in Tillman is not confined to Bournemouth.
Fulham and Brentford are described as the most advanced suitors, both willing to match the Bundesliga side’s initial outlay. Fulham, in particular, see him as a natural successor to Harry Wilson, while Brentford’s model of intelligent attacking recruitment makes their interest unsurprising. Photo: IMAGO Bournemouth’s involvement, though, adds a different dynamic.
Their recent evolution under a progressive structure suggests a willingness to invest in players who can elevate their attacking ceiling. Tillman, capable of operating centrally or drifting wide, fits that mould neatly. Player Profile and Premier League Appeal At 23, Tillman embodies a modern attacking midfielder, comfortable between lines, technically assured, and capable of contributing goals.
